The cheapest way to get from Yuma to San Ysidro is to drive which costs $29 - $45 and takes 3h 6m.
The fastest way to get from Yuma to San Ysidro is to drive which takes 3h 6m and costs $29 - $45.
No, there is no direct bus from Yuma to San Ysidro. However, there are services departing from Yuma County Area Transit and arriving at Tijuana via C. José Azueta y Blvr. López Mateos and Mexicali.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 4h 58m.
The distance between Yuma and San Ysidro is 167 miles. The road distance is 164.6 miles.
The best way to get from Yuma to San Ysidro without a car is to bus via Mexicali which takes 4h 58m and costs $45 - $75.
It takes approximately 4h 58m to get from Yuma to San Ysidro, including transfers.
